In the 2018 season Norwegian Breakaway will be calling in Rostock/Warnemünde roughly every 9 days.

According to the Port of Rostock Cruise Ship call schedule for 2018

(http://www.rostock-port.de/en/cruise-shipping/port-calls/2018-port-calls.html)

on 17th and 26th June she will berth in the Rostock Overseas Port (berth LP31) and for the rest of her calls will berth at the Warnemünde Cruise Terminal (berth P8).

 

Please note that with the exception of Aida ships, which have priority in the Cruise Terminal, cruise ships do not necessarily berth in the same place on each call. On the above web site you will find the official berthing schedule issued by the Port of Rostock Authority. Once assigned berths are only changed in exceptional circumstances as they are organized months, even years, in advance. There are also some very useful maps of both the Overseas Port and the Cruise Terminal and other general information about Rostock and Warnemünde on the same web site
